diff --git a/lib/node_modules/@stdlib/namespace/alias2pkg/data/data.csv b/lib/node_modules/@stdlib/namespace/alias2pkg/data/data.csv
index 0beda5c23b05..7c7a901a5502 100644
--- a/lib/node_modules/@stdlib/namespace/alias2pkg/data/data.csv
+++ b/lib/node_modules/@stdlib/namespace/alias2pkg/data/data.csv
@@ -2662,7 +2662,7 @@ Object,"@stdlib/object/ctor"
objectEntries,"@stdlib/utils/entries"
objectEntriesIn,"@stdlib/utils/entries-in"
objectFromEntries,"@stdlib/utils/from-entries"
-objectInverse,"@stdlib/utils/object-inverse"
+objectInverse,"@stdlib/object/inverse"
objectInverseBy,"@stdlib/utils/object-inverse-by"
objectKeys,"@stdlib/utils/keys"
objectValues,"@stdlib/utils/values"
diff --git a/lib/node_modules/@stdlib/namespace/lib/namespace/o.js b/lib/node_modules/@stdlib/namespace/lib/namespace/o.js
index ff68023204bd..262be8c2ea43 100644
--- a/lib/node_modules/@stdlib/namespace/lib/namespace/o.js
+++ b/lib/node_modules/@stdlib/namespace/lib/namespace/o.js
@@ -72,8 +72,8 @@ ns.push({
ns.push({
'alias': 'objectInverse',
- 'path': '@stdlib/utils/object-inverse',
- 'value': require( '@stdlib/utils/object-inverse' ),
+ 'path': '@stdlib/object/inverse',
+ 'value': require( '@stdlib/object/inverse' ),
'type': 'Function',
'related': [
'@stdlib/utils/object-inverse-by'
@@ -86,7 +86,7 @@ ns.push({
'value': require( '@stdlib/utils/object-inverse-by' ),
'type': 'Function',
'related': [
- '@stdlib/utils/object-inverse'
+ '@stdlib/object/inverse'
]
});
diff --git a/lib/node_modules/@stdlib/namespace/pkg2alias/data/data.csv b/lib/node_modules/@stdlib/namespace/pkg2alias/data/data.csv
index 129167495b6f..11fbf9008bef 100644
--- a/lib/node_modules/@stdlib/namespace/pkg2alias/data/data.csv
+++ b/lib/node_modules/@stdlib/namespace/pkg2alias/data/data.csv
@@ -2662,7 +2662,7 @@
"@stdlib/utils/entries",objectEntries
"@stdlib/utils/entries-in",objectEntriesIn
"@stdlib/utils/from-entries",objectFromEntries
-"@stdlib/utils/object-inverse",objectInverse
+"@stdlib/object/inverse",objectInverse
"@stdlib/utils/object-inverse-by",objectInverseBy
"@stdlib/utils/keys",objectKeys
"@stdlib/utils/values",objectValues
diff --git a/lib/node_modules/@stdlib/namespace/pkg2related/data/data.csv b/lib/node_modules/@stdlib/namespace/pkg2related/data/data.csv
index 522dc6186513..5482bfbcb7ff 100644
--- a/lib/node_modules/@stdlib/namespace/pkg2related/data/data.csv
+++ b/lib/node_modules/@stdlib/namespace/pkg2related/data/data.csv
@@ -2662,8 +2662,8 @@
"@stdlib/utils/entries","@stdlib/utils/entries-in,@stdlib/utils/from-entries,@stdlib/utils/keys,@stdlib/utils/values"
"@stdlib/utils/entries-in","@stdlib/utils/entries,@stdlib/utils/from-entries,@stdlib/utils/keys-in,@stdlib/utils/values-in"
"@stdlib/utils/from-entries","@stdlib/utils/entries"
-"@stdlib/utils/object-inverse","@stdlib/utils/object-inverse-by"
-"@stdlib/utils/object-inverse-by","@stdlib/utils/object-inverse"
+"@stdlib/object/inverse","@stdlib/utils/object-inverse-by"
+"@stdlib/utils/object-inverse-by","@stdlib/object/inverse"
"@stdlib/utils/keys","@stdlib/utils/entries,@stdlib/utils/keys-in,@stdlib/utils/nonindex-keys,@stdlib/utils/values"
"@stdlib/utils/values","@stdlib/utils/entries,@stdlib/utils/keys"
"@stdlib/utils/values-in","@stdlib/utils/entries-in,@stdlib/utils/keys-in,@stdlib/utils/values"
diff --git a/lib/node_modules/@stdlib/namespace/pkg2standalone/data/data.csv b/lib/node_modules/@stdlib/namespace/pkg2standalone/data/data.csv
index 60bdd7af0bc3..c459c7534c7a 100644
--- a/lib/node_modules/@stdlib/namespace/pkg2standalone/data/data.csv
+++ b/lib/node_modules/@stdlib/namespace/pkg2standalone/data/data.csv
@@ -2662,7 +2662,7 @@
"@stdlib/utils/entries","@stdlib/utils-entries"
"@stdlib/utils/entries-in","@stdlib/utils-entries-in"
"@stdlib/utils/from-entries","@stdlib/utils-from-entries"
-"@stdlib/utils/object-inverse","@stdlib/utils-object-inverse"
+"@stdlib/object/inverse","@stdlib/object-inverse"
"@stdlib/utils/object-inverse-by","@stdlib/utils-object-inverse-by"
"@stdlib/utils/keys","@stdlib/utils-keys"
"@stdlib/utils/values","@stdlib/utils-values"
diff --git a/lib/node_modules/@stdlib/namespace/standalone2pkg/data/data.csv b/lib/node_modules/@stdlib/namespace/standalone2pkg/data/data.csv
index 1571d9805f5e..caa0114203d4 100644
--- a/lib/node_modules/@stdlib/namespace/standalone2pkg/data/data.csv
+++ b/lib/node_modules/@stdlib/namespace/standalone2pkg/data/data.csv
@@ -2662,7 +2662,7 @@
"@stdlib/utils-entries","@stdlib/utils/entries"
"@stdlib/utils-entries-in","@stdlib/utils/entries-in"
"@stdlib/utils-from-entries","@stdlib/utils/from-entries"
-"@stdlib/utils-object-inverse","@stdlib/utils/object-inverse"
+"@stdlib/object-inverse","@stdlib/object/inverse"
"@stdlib/utils-object-inverse-by","@stdlib/utils/object-inverse-by"
"@stdlib/utils-keys","@stdlib/utils/keys"
"@stdlib/utils-values","@stdlib/utils/values"
diff --git a/lib/node_modules/@stdlib/ndarray/base/dtype-enum2str/lib/main.js b/lib/node_modules/@stdlib/ndarray/base/dtype-enum2str/lib/main.js
index 5dd034975c98..8a2ad428453d 100644
--- a/lib/node_modules/@stdlib/ndarray/base/dtype-enum2str/lib/main.js
+++ b/lib/node_modules/@stdlib/ndarray/base/dtype-enum2str/lib/main.js
@@ -21,7 +21,7 @@
// MODULES //
var isString = require( '@stdlib/assert/is-string' ).isPrimitive;
-var objectInverse = require( '@stdlib/utils/object-inverse' );
+var objectInverse = require( '@stdlib/object/inverse' );
var dtypeEnums = require( '@stdlib/ndarray/base/dtype-enums' );
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/README.md b/lib/node_modules/@stdlib/object/inverse/README.md
similarity index 97%
rename from lib/node_modules/@stdlib/utils/object-inverse/README.md
rename to lib/node_modules/@stdlib/object/inverse/README.md
index a33fe8d63fd8..af495c45b03e 100644
--- a/lib/node_modules/@stdlib/utils/object-inverse/README.md
+++ b/lib/node_modules/@stdlib/object/inverse/README.md
@@ -27,7 +27,7 @@ limitations under the License.
## Usage
```javascript
-var invert = require( '@stdlib/utils/object-inverse' );
+var invert = require( '@stdlib/object/inverse' );
```
#### invert( obj\[, options] )
@@ -107,7 +107,7 @@ var out = invert( obj, {
```javascript
var randu = require( '@stdlib/random/base/randu' );
var round = require( '@stdlib/math/base/special/round' );
-var invert = require( '@stdlib/utils/object-inverse' );
+var invert = require( '@stdlib/object/inverse' );
var keys;
var arr;
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/benchmark/benchmark.js b/lib/node_modules/@stdlib/object/inverse/benchmark/benchmark.js
similarity index 100%
rename from lib/node_modules/@stdlib/utils/object-inverse/benchmark/benchmark.js
rename to lib/node_modules/@stdlib/object/inverse/benchmark/benchmark.js
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/docs/repl.txt b/lib/node_modules/@stdlib/object/inverse/docs/repl.txt
similarity index 100%
rename from lib/node_modules/@stdlib/utils/object-inverse/docs/repl.txt
rename to lib/node_modules/@stdlib/object/inverse/docs/repl.txt
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/docs/types/index.d.ts b/lib/node_modules/@stdlib/object/inverse/docs/types/index.d.ts
similarity index 100%
rename from lib/node_modules/@stdlib/utils/object-inverse/docs/types/index.d.ts
rename to lib/node_modules/@stdlib/object/inverse/docs/types/index.d.ts
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/docs/types/test.ts b/lib/node_modules/@stdlib/object/inverse/docs/types/test.ts
similarity index 100%
rename from lib/node_modules/@stdlib/utils/object-inverse/docs/types/test.ts
rename to lib/node_modules/@stdlib/object/inverse/docs/types/test.ts
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/examples/index.js b/lib/node_modules/@stdlib/object/inverse/examples/index.js
similarity index 100%
rename from lib/node_modules/@stdlib/utils/object-inverse/examples/index.js
rename to lib/node_modules/@stdlib/object/inverse/examples/index.js
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/lib/index.js b/lib/node_modules/@stdlib/object/inverse/lib/index.js
similarity index 92%
rename from lib/node_modules/@stdlib/utils/object-inverse/lib/index.js
rename to lib/node_modules/@stdlib/object/inverse/lib/index.js
index 313f1705ad48..835c30fecf56 100644
--- a/lib/node_modules/@stdlib/utils/object-inverse/lib/index.js
+++ b/lib/node_modules/@stdlib/object/inverse/lib/index.js
@@ -21,10 +21,10 @@
/**
* Invert an object, such that keys become values and values become keys.
*
-* @module @stdlib/utils/object-inverse
+* @module @stdlib/object/inverse
*
* @example
-* var invert = require( '@stdlib/utils/object-inverse' );
+* var invert = require( '@stdlib/object/inverse' );
*
* var out = invert({
* 'a': 'beep',
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/lib/main.js b/lib/node_modules/@stdlib/object/inverse/lib/main.js
similarity index 100%
rename from lib/node_modules/@stdlib/utils/object-inverse/lib/main.js
rename to lib/node_modules/@stdlib/object/inverse/lib/main.js
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/package.json b/lib/node_modules/@stdlib/object/inverse/package.json
similarity index 96%
rename from lib/node_modules/@stdlib/utils/object-inverse/package.json
rename to lib/node_modules/@stdlib/object/inverse/package.json
index fcca361da5cf..cd52ddfea37b 100644
--- a/lib/node_modules/@stdlib/utils/object-inverse/package.json
+++ b/lib/node_modules/@stdlib/object/inverse/package.json
@@ -1,5 +1,5 @@
{
- "name": "@stdlib/utils/object-inverse",
+ "name": "@stdlib/object/inverse",
"version": "0.0.0",
"description": "Invert an object, such that keys become values and values become keys.",
"license": "Apache-2.0",
diff --git a/lib/node_modules/@stdlib/utils/object-inverse/test/test.js b/lib/node_modules/@stdlib/object/inverse/test/test.js
similarity index 100%
rename from lib/node_modules/@stdlib/utils/object-inverse/test/test.js
rename to lib/node_modules/@stdlib/object/inverse/test/test.js
diff --git a/lib/node_modules/@stdlib/utils/docs/types/index.d.ts b/lib/node_modules/@stdlib/utils/docs/types/index.d.ts
index 6af6c2aa5bf0..2a16957f937e 100644
--- a/lib/node_modules/@stdlib/utils/docs/types/index.d.ts
+++ b/lib/node_modules/@stdlib/utils/docs/types/index.d.ts
@@ -151,7 +151,6 @@ import nonEnumerablePropertySymbols = require( '@stdlib/utils/nonenumerable-prop
import nonEnumerablePropertySymbolsIn = require( '@stdlib/utils/nonenumerable-property-symbols-in' );
import nonIndexKeys = require( '@stdlib/utils/nonindex-keys' );
import noop = require( '@stdlib/utils/noop' );
-import objectInverse = require( '@stdlib/utils/object-inverse' );
import objectInverseBy = require( '@stdlib/utils/object-inverse-by' );
import omit = require( '@stdlib/utils/omit' );
import omitBy = require( '@stdlib/utils/omit-by' );
@@ -4016,41 +4015,6 @@ interface Namespace {
*/
noop: typeof noop;
- /**
- * Inverts an object, such that keys become values and values become keys.
- *
- * @param obj - input object
- * @param options - function options
- * @param options.duplicates - boolean indicating whether to store duplicate keys (default: true)
- * @returns inverted object
- *
- * @example
- * var out = ns.objectInverse({
- * 'a': 'beep',
- * 'b': 'boop'
- * });
- * // returns { 'beep': 'a', 'boop': 'b' }
- *
- * @example
- * var out = ns.objectInverse({
- * 'a': 'beep',
- * 'b': 'beep'
- * });
- * // returns { 'beep': [ 'a', 'b' ] }
- *
- * @example
- * var obj = {};
- * obj.a = 'beep';
- * obj.b = 'boop';
- * obj.c = 'beep'; // inserted after `a`
- *
- * var out = ns.objectInverse( obj, {
- * 'duplicates': false
- * });
- * // returns { 'beep': 'c', 'boop': 'b' }
- */
- objectInverse: typeof objectInverse;
-
/**
* Inverts an object, such that keys become values and values become keys, according to a transform function.
*
diff --git a/lib/node_modules/@stdlib/utils/lib/index.js b/lib/node_modules/@stdlib/utils/lib/index.js
index badc25367154..42513e32a6c7 100644
--- a/lib/node_modules/@stdlib/utils/lib/index.js
+++ b/lib/node_modules/@stdlib/utils/lib/index.js
@@ -1219,15 +1219,6 @@ setReadOnly( utils, 'nonIndexKeys', require( '@stdlib/utils/nonindex-keys' ) );
*/
setReadOnly( utils, 'noop', require( '@stdlib/utils/noop' ) );
-/**
-* @name objectInverse
-* @memberof utils
-* @readonly
-* @type {Function}
-* @see {@link module:@stdlib/utils/object-inverse}
-*/
-setReadOnly( utils, 'objectInverse', require( '@stdlib/utils/object-inverse' ) );
-
/**
* @name objectInverseBy
* @memberof utils
diff --git a/lib/node_modules/@stdlib/utils/object-inverse-by/README.md b/lib/node_modules/@stdlib/utils/object-inverse-by/README.md
index 8c1651d1a57a..90db015652bd 100644
--- a/lib/node_modules/@stdlib/utils/object-inverse-by/README.md
+++ b/lib/node_modules/@stdlib/utils/object-inverse-by/README.md
@@ -182,7 +182,7 @@ console.dir( out );
## See Also
-- [`@stdlib/utils/object-inverse`][@stdlib/utils/object-inverse]: invert an object, such that keys become values and values become keys.
+- [`@stdlib/object/inverse`][@stdlib/object/inverse]: invert an object, such that keys become values and values become keys.
@@ -196,7 +196,7 @@ console.dir( out );
-[@stdlib/utils/object-inverse]: https://github.com/stdlib-js/stdlib/tree/develop/lib/node_modules/%40stdlib/utils/object-inverse
+[@stdlib/object/inverse]: https://github.com/stdlib-js/stdlib/tree/develop/lib/node_modules/%40stdlib/object/inverse